What companies run services between Andover, England and Salisbury, England?
South Western Railway operates a train from Andover to Salisbury hourly. Tickets cost £7–16 and the journey takes 20 min. Alternatively, Salisbury Reds operates a bus from Andover Station to Castle Street every 30 minutes, and the journey takes 1h 26m. Stagecoach South also services this route once daily.
